The True Cost of Buying a Roof Box from Halfords
Let’s break down the typical costs of buying roof storage equipment from Halfords.
- Roof Bars: £150 – £250 (depending on vehicle type and brand)
- Roof Box: £450 – £600 (for a mid-range or premium Thule model)
So before you’ve even lifted your luggage, you’re already spending between £600 and £850 — and that doesn’t include fitting. Halfords does offer fitting services, but there’s usually a fitting charge of £25–£40, and that’s just for installation. You’ll still need to remove and store the box later.
Now compare that with hiring. A 7-day hire from West Midlands Roof Box Hire typically costs a fraction of the purchase price — much less than what you’d pay just for roof bars. If you only use a roof box once or twice a year (as most people do), it’s easy to see which option makes more sense financially.

Storage Space: The Problem Nobody Talks About
Roof boxes are bulky — even when empty. A large box (like the 580-litre Thule Motion XT) can be around 2 metres long and weighs over 20kg.
If you’ve ever tried to store one, you’ll know how awkward they are. Garages, lofts, and sheds aren’t ideal — they take up valuable space and are easily damaged. Hiring completely eliminates that problem.

Maintenance and Longevity
Like anything exposed to the elements, roof boxes wear over time. UV light, rain, and grit can damage seals and hinges, meaning a purchased box may not last as long as you’d hope — especially if it’s stored outdoors.
